Yuma lies in southwestern Arizona near international, desert, agricultural, and military-aviation landscapes. Wide horizons and dark skies can support long-distance visibility, but apparent distance and height of lights over a flat or low-relief horizon can be difficult to judge. Dust, haze, heat gradients, and the visual compression of distant lights may also alter perceived brightness, motion, and scale.
Marine Corps Air Station Yuma, regional military ranges, civilian airports, and air traffic are relevant contextual organisations and infrastructures. Their relevance is environmental, not evidentiary: this dossier does not attribute any sighting to them, assert access to their records, or imply that restricted airspace indicates a concealed program.
The setting can shape both perception and reporting. A witness who knows the area’s aviation culture may identify familiar activity accurately, while another may interpret a distant formation or flare display as exceptional. Conversely, familiarity should not be assumed either way without actual testimony.

The most productive first step would be disaggregation. Researchers should locate the earliest available record for every claimed Yuma-area 2014 observation, retain the original date and time exactly as written, identify whether the report was first-hand, and avoid merging nearby but differently dated reports merely because they share a city label.
Each recovered report should then be compared with time-specific conventional data where available: scheduled and observed aviation activity, airport approaches, visible military training or public notices, astronomical objects and satellite passes, meteor or re-entry reports, weather, cloud cover, visibility, wind, and local events involving illuminated aircraft or pyrotechnics. Positive matches and failed matches should both be recorded with their limits.
Photographs or videos, if discovered, require provenance checks before interpretation. Useful questions include original-file availability, capture time, device orientation, exposure settings, frame continuity, edits, foreground landmarks, and whether a light’s apparent motion matches camera shake, autofocus hunting, zoom, or rolling-shutter effects. None of those materials is presently known to exist.

Military activity is both relevant and easy to overread. Night training, aviation lighting, and range-related illumination could offer mundane explanations in this region, but a general association with nearby installations does not prove that a specific observation was military. The opposite inference is equally unsound: the presence of restricted areas does not convert an unidentified report into evidence of secrecy.
Aircraft can appear unexpectedly stationary when approaching head-on, can seem to accelerate or turn when their angle changes, and may show conspicuous red, green, white, or strobed lights. Flares may hang, descend slowly, brighten or extinguish abruptly, and appear grouped. Distant helicopters, drones, satellites, bright planets near the horizon, meteors, and reflections all remain hypothesis classes, not established solutions for this unspecific cluster.
A social explanation also requires attention. Online reposting can smooth away dates, locations, uncertainty, and mundane context, creating an apparent wave of sightings from unrelated testimony. Conversely, a skeptical retelling can flatten genuinely unusual witness detail. Preserving report versions and their publication order is essential before deciding whether the cluster was a single event, several events, or a later narrative aggregation.

Cross-case connections
The strongest comparison motif is the military-adjacent light report. Comparable cases often arise near air bases, training ranges, or approach corridors, where legitimate aviation can be visually dramatic and where public assumptions about secrecy can shape interpretation. The comparison should test exact timing and geometry, not rely on proximity alone.
A second motif is the sparse nocturnal-light report. Cases consisting mainly of unidentified lights often lack reliable range, scale, and direction, making perceptual explanations and observational uncertainty central. They should be compared with flare, aircraft-approach, satellite, and astronomical misidentification cases while retaining the possibility that the available record is simply insufficient.
A third motif is cluster formation through transmission. Researchers can compare whether several nominal sightings share independent timestamps and vantage points, or whether they descend from one circulating post. This motif connects the Yuma label to broader studies of rumor, database duplication, media amplification, and retrospective case construction.
A fourth motif is desert-horizon perception. Long viewing distances, isolated points of light, atmospheric effects, and limited foreground reference can make ordinary sources appear airborne, close, or unusually mobile. This does not dismiss witnesses; it identifies a recurring environmental variable that should be assessed case by case.
